Unashamed Of The Gospel Of Jesus Christ (Blu-ray)
$24.98
This full length documentary gives the most in-depth look ever into the lives of the members of BFA, their personal history, life on the road, live performances, the sacrifices of being gone over 200 days a year, various interviews and candid footage, and what it means to truly be “Unashamed Of The Gospel Of Jesus Christ.” It is an 80 minute documentary, and you will not want to miss seeing it! It was produced, directed, filmed, and edited by Brian’s son, Bryce Free.
The DVD will play in all dvd players, laptops, etc. and is a standard definition copy of the documentary. The Blu-Ray, however, is in full 1080p high definition, the full and highest quality in which the documentary was filmed. But keep in mind, Blu-Rays will ONLY play in Blu-Ray players, Playstation 3 and 4, and any computer that may have a Blu-Ray drive. So if you have the ability to play a Blu-Ray, we HIGHLY recommend that you get it! But if you do not have a Blu-Ray player, you will still fully enjoy the DVD! It is the exact same film, but just in DVD quality as opposed to being in 1080p high definition. Also, the sound on both the DVD and Blu-Ray is in 5.1 Surround Sound, so for those of you that have a home surround sound system, you will thoroughly enjoy that!
